Across TCGA patient cohorts, HTATSF1 RNA expression is significantly associated with the protein abundance of many other proteins, with 16,388 significant associations in total. LSCC shows the largest number of these associations.

The most reproducible HTATSF1-associated proteins across cancer lineages are PHF6, HTATSF1_S481, and CUL4B. Each is linked with HTATSF1 in more than 6 cancer types. Because this analysis shows association rather than direction, both HTATSF1-to-partner and partner-to-HTATSF1 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, HTATSF1 versus PHF6 in LSCC, with a Pearson correlation of 0.74.
